About This Treatment

Tooth extraction is the removal of a tooth from its socket in the jawbone. While dentists always prefer to save natural teeth, extraction becomes necessary when a tooth is too damaged, decayed, or infected to repair, or when wisdom teeth are causing problems. Extractions are also performed to prepare for other treatments like implants, dentures, or orthodontics. A simple extraction is performed on a tooth that is visible above the gum line. The dentist loosens the tooth with an instrument called an elevator, then removes it with forceps. A surgical extraction is needed when a tooth has broken off at the gum line or has not fully emerged (impacted). This involves making a small incision in the gum and sometimes removing a small amount of bone to access the tooth. Modern extraction techniques are gentler than ever, with most patients reporting that the procedure was easier than they expected. The socket typically heals within one to two weeks, and the dentist will provide specific aftercare instructions to ensure smooth recovery.

Risks & Considerations

  • Dry socket (the blood clot dislodges from the extraction site, causing pain — occurs in about 2-5% of cases)
  • Temporary numbness if the tooth was near the nerve (lower wisdom teeth)
  • Infection if aftercare instructions are not followed
  • Minor bleeding for 24 hours is normal; excessive bleeding is rare

How painful is a tooth extraction?

The procedure itself is painless under local anaesthetic — you will feel pressure but not pain. Afterwards, mild to moderate soreness is normal for 2-3 days and is well managed with over-the-counter painkillers.

How long does it take to recover from an extraction?

Most patients feel significantly better within 2-3 days. The socket takes 1-2 weeks to heal over with gum tissue. Full bone healing takes 3-4 months, which is relevant if you are planning an implant.

What is dry socket and how do I avoid it?

Dry socket occurs when the blood clot in the extraction site is dislodged, exposing the bone. Avoid drinking through straws, spitting forcefully, and smoking for 3-5 days after extraction. These are the main preventable causes.

Why is Budapest called the Dental Capital of Europe?

Hungary has been a dental tourism destination since the 1980s, originally serving Austrian and German patients. Budapest now treats over 100,000 international dental patients annually. The combination of highly trained dentists, EU regulation, and prices 50-70% lower than Western Europe created this reputation.
